编程学的是什么东西图片
-
编程学习的是一种计算机科学技能,它涉及到编写和设计计算机程序的过程。通过编程,人们可以使用特定的编程语言来创建软件、网站、游戏和其他计算机应用程序。
在编程学习过程中,学习者需要掌握以下几个方面的知识和技能:
-
编程语言:编程语言是学习编程的基础,不同的编程语言有不同的语法和用途。常见的编程语言包括Python、Java、C++、JavaScript等。学习者需要了解编程语言的基本语法和特性,以及如何使用它们来解决问题和实现功能。
-
算法和数据结构:算法是解决问题的方法和步骤,而数据结构是组织和存储数据的方式。学习者需要学习常见的算法和数据结构,以及它们的原理和应用。这些知识可以帮助学习者提高程序的效率和性能。
-
软件开发工具:学习者需要了解和熟练使用一些常用的软件开发工具,如集成开发环境(IDE)、代码编辑器、调试器等。这些工具可以帮助学习者更高效地编写、调试和测试代码。
-
问题解决能力:编程学习不仅仅是学习语法和工具,更重要的是培养问题解决能力。学习者需要学会分析问题、提出解决方案,并将其转化为可执行的程序。这需要学习者具备逻辑思维和创造力。
总之,编程学习是一项需要耐心和实践的技能,它可以帮助人们理解计算机的工作原理,并且能够通过编写代码来实现自己的想法和创意。无论是从事软件开发、网站设计还是数据分析,掌握编程技能都是一种有价值的能力。
1年前 -
-
编程学习的是一种技能和思维方式,通过编写代码来创建和操作计算机程序。以下是编程学习的五个关键要素:
-
编程语言:编程语言是一种用于编写计算机程序的形式化语言。常见的编程语言包括Python、Java、C++等。学习编程需要掌握基本的语法和概念,以及如何使用不同的编程语言来解决问题。
-
算法和数据结构:算法是解决问题的一系列有序步骤。学习算法可以帮助开发者设计高效的程序,提高代码的执行效率。数据结构是组织和存储数据的方式,例如数组、链表和树等。了解不同的数据结构可以帮助开发者选择最适合的存储方式。
-
逻辑思维:编程需要开发者具备良好的逻辑思维能力,能够将问题拆分成更小的子问题,并设计合适的解决方案。逻辑思维包括分析问题、寻找模式和推理推断等。
-
问题解决能力:编程学习培养了解决问题的能力。在编程中,开发者需要分析问题、寻找解决方案,并将其转化为可执行的代码。这种问题解决能力在解决实际生活中的各种问题时也非常有用。
-
持续学习:编程是一个不断学习和发展的领域。技术不断更新,新的编程语言和工具不断出现。因此,编程学习需要具备持续学习的能力,不断跟进最新的技术和发展趋势。同时,学习也需要不断实践和探索,通过编写代码来加深理解和提高技能。
总之,编程学习不仅仅是掌握一门编程语言,还需要培养逻辑思维、问题解决能力和持续学习的能力。通过不断学习和实践,可以成为一名优秀的程序员,并在软件开发领域取得成功。
1年前 -
-
编程学习的是一种计算机技能,它涉及了编写、测试和维护计算机程序的过程。通过编程,人们可以将自己的思想和想法转化为计算机可以理解和执行的指令,从而实现各种功能和任务。
编程的核心是使用编程语言来编写代码,这些代码告诉计算机要执行的操作。编程语言可以是高级语言(如Python、Java、C++等)或低级语言(如汇编语言),不同的编程语言适用于不同的应用领域和开发需求。
为了学习编程,你需要了解一些基本的概念和原理,包括:
-
算法和数据结构:算法是解决问题的步骤和方法,数据结构是组织和存储数据的方式。学习算法和数据结构可以帮助你优化代码的效率和性能。
-
语法和语义:每种编程语言都有自己的语法规则和语义规范,你需要学习如何正确地使用这些规则和规范来编写有效的代码。
-
编程范式:编程范式是一种编程思想和方法论,它定义了如何组织和设计代码。常见的编程范式包括面向对象编程(OOP)、函数式编程(FP)等。
-
调试和错误处理:编程过程中难免会出现错误和bug,学会调试和错误处理是解决问题的关键。你需要学会使用调试工具和技术来定位和修复错误。
-
版本控制:版本控制是一种管理和追踪代码变更的方法。学习版本控制可以帮助你更好地协作、追踪和管理代码。
在学习编程过程中,你可以按照以下步骤进行:
-
学习基础知识:了解计算机科学基础知识、编程语言的基本语法和常用的数据结构和算法。
-
练习编写代码:通过解决问题、完成小项目等方式来锻炼编程能力,提高代码的质量和效率。
-
参与开源项目:参与开源项目可以让你接触到实际的编程工作,学习和其他开发者一起协作、交流和分享经验。
-
持续学习和实践:编程是一个不断学习和实践的过程,你需要保持学习的动力,不断提升自己的技术水平。
总之,编程学习需要不断的实践和经验积累,只有通过不断地编写代码和解决问题,才能不断提高自己的编程能力。
1年前 -